cocco
▪ I. ‖ ˈcocco Also 9 cocoa, coco, pl. cocoes. The tuber of an Araceous plant Colocasia esculenta or taro-plant, cultivated in the West Indies as an article of food. Also called coco-, cocoa-root.1756 P. Browne Jamaica 332 The purple cocco, and Tannier..The roots supply the poorer sort of people with... Oxford English Dictionary

Giovanni Cocco
Giovanni Cocco (1 June 1921 – 7 January 2007) was an Italian weightlifter. He competed in the men's featherweight event at the 1952 Summer Olympics. wikipedia.org

Miguel Cocco
Miguel Salvador Cocco Guerrero (August 21, 1946 – May 20, 2009) was a Dominican businessman and politician. Born in Santiago; his parents Manuel A. Cocco and Gisela Guerrero moved with him to Santo Domingo when he was at an early age. wikipedia.org
